Sales applicants have rated the interview process at Terminix with 2 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 80% positive. To compare, the company-average is 51.6%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Sales roles take an average of 6 days to get hired, when considering 5 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Terminix overall takes an average of 17 days.
Common stages of the interview process at Terminix as a Sales according to 5 Glassdoor interviews include:
Phone interview: 18%
Drug test: 18%
Skills test: 18%
Background check: 12%
IQ intelligence test: 12%
One on one interview: 12%
Personality test: 6%
Presentation: 6%

I applied online. The process took 1 week. I interviewed at Terminix (Lancaster, PA) in Mar 2014
Interview
Met with Branch Manager talked about resume and if I was ever in outside sales before? willingness to travel. I was offered the job about a week later went in for a drug test.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
Are you willing to go into tight places (crawl spaces) willingness to travel.

I applied online. I interviewed at Terminix (Corpus Christi, TX) in Feb 2022
Interview
Describe time you helped a difficult customer. The interview was on my phone and my answers were recorded. I could record my answers multiple times if I chose. The process took my a half hour and I found it to be very easy. I believe there were four questions.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
Describe time you went above and beyond to help a customer.
